Gut microbiota-produced succinate promotes C. difficile infection after antibiotic treatment or motility disturbance
Clostridium difficile is a leading cause of antibiotic-associated diarrhea. The mechanisms underlying C. difficile expansion after microbiota disturbance are just emerging.
